What it is
BEVACIP is bevacizumab 100 mg/4 mL and 400 mg/16 mL concentrated solution for infusion in vials. BEVACIP is a biosimilar medicine to Avastin. The evidence for comparability supports the use of BEVACIP for the listed indications. Bevacizumab is a recombinant humanised monoclonal antibody that selectively binds to and neutralises the biologic activity of human vascular endothelial growth factor (VEGF). Bevacizumab inhibits the binding of VEGF to its receptors on the surface of endothelial cells, and neutralising the biologic activity of VEGF reduces the vascularisation of tumours, thereby inhibiting tumour growth.
Approved indications
— Metastatic colorectal cancer, in combination with fluoropyrimidine-based chemotherapy. — Locally recurrent or metastatic breast cancer, in combination with paclitaxel for first-line treatment in patients in whom an anthracycline-based therapy is contraindicated. — Advanced, metastatic or recurrent non-squamous non-small cell lung cancer, in combination with carboplatin and paclitaxel for first-line treatment. — Advanced and/or metastatic renal cell cancer, in combination with interferon alfa-2a. — Grade IV glioma as a single agent for treatment after relapse or disease progression after standard therapy. — Advanced epithelial ovarian, fallopian tube or primary peritoneal cancer, in combination with carboplatin and paclitaxel for first-line treatment. — Recurrent epithelial ovarian, fallopian tube or primary peritoneal cancer, in combination with carboplatin and paclitaxel or carboplatin and gemcitabine for first recurrence of platinum-sensitive disease, or in combination with paclitaxel, topotecan or pegylated liposomal doxorubicin for recurrent platinum-resistant disease. — Persistent, recurrent or metastatic cervical cancer, in combination with paclitaxel and cisplatin or paclitaxel and topotecan.
Dosing overview
For metastatic colorectal cancer, first-line treatment requires 5 mg/kg intravenously every 2 weeks or 7.5 mg/kg every 3 weeks; second-line treatment requires 10 mg/kg every 2 weeks or 15 mg/kg every 3 weeks. For locally recurrent or metastatic breast cancer, the recommended dose is 10 mg/kg every 2 weeks or 15 mg/kg every 3 weeks. For advanced, metastatic or recurrent non-squamous non-small cell lung cancer, the recommended dose is 15 mg/kg every 3 weeks. For advanced and/or metastatic renal cell cancer, the recommended dose is 10 mg/kg every 2 weeks. For Grade IV glioma, the recommended dose is 10 mg/kg every 2 weeks or 15 mg/kg every 3 weeks. For epithelial ovarian, fallopian tube or primary peritoneal cancer first-line treatment, the recommended dose is 15 mg/kg every 3 weeks for up to 6 cycles with chemotherapy followed by continued BEVACIP monotherapy for a total of 15 months or until disease progression. For cervical cancer, the recommended dose is 15 mg/kg every 3 weeks until progression of the underlying disease. The initial infusion should be delivered over 90 minutes; if well tolerated, the second infusion may be given over 60 minutes, and if that is well tolerated, subsequent infusions may be given over 30 minutes.
Key safety warnings
Patients may be at increased risk for gastrointestinal perforation and gallbladder perforation when treated with BEVACIP, and bevacizumab should be permanently discontinued in patients who develop gastrointestinal perforation. Fatal outcome was reported in approximately a third of serious cases of gastrointestinal perforations, representing between 0.2% and 1% of all bevacizumab-treated patients. An increased incidence of hypertension was observed in patients treated with bevacizumab, and clinical safety data suggest that the incidence is likely to be dose-dependent. Pre-existing hypertension should be adequately controlled before starting bevacizumab treatment. Bevacizumab should be permanently discontinued if medically significant hypertension cannot be adequately controlled with antihypertensive therapy, or if the patient develops hypertensive crisis or hypertensive encephalopathy. Bevacizumab may adversely affect the wound healing process; therapy should not be initiated for at least 28 days following major surgery or until the surgical wound is fully healed, and should be withheld in patients who experience wound healing complications during therapy. Serious wound healing complications, including anastomotic complications, have been reported, some of which had a fatal outcome. An increased incidence of arterial thromboembolic events including cerebrovascular accidents, myocardial infarction and transient ischaemic attacks has been observed, with an overall incidence ranging up to 5.9% in bevacizumab-containing arms compared with up to 1.7% in chemotherapy control arms. Bevacizumab should be permanently discontinued in patients who develop arterial thromboembolic events. Patients treated with bevacizumab have an increased risk of haemorrhage, especially tumour-associated haemorrhage, and bevacizumab should be permanently discontinued in patients who experience Grade 3 or 4 bleeding. Patients with non-small cell lung cancer treated with bevacizumab may be at risk for serious and in some cases fatal pulmonary haemorrhage or haemoptysis; patients with recent pulmonary haemorrhage or haemoptysis should not be treated with bevacizumab. Patients with a history of hypertension may be at increased risk for the development of proteinuria when treated with bevacizumab, and there is evidence suggesting that all grade proteinuria may be dose-dependent; testing for proteinuria is recommended prior to the start of bevacizumab therapy.
Contraindications
BEVACIP is contraindicated in patients with known hypersensitivity to any components of the product, Chinese hamster ovary cell products or other recombinant human or humanised antibodies.
Regulatory history
The TGA approved BEVACIP (bevacizumab) on 13 October 2021. The approval was based on the evaluation finding no objections on quality grounds and the sponsor demonstrating comparability to the reference product, Avastin. BEVACIP bevacizumab 100 mg/4 mL and 400 mg/16 mL concentrated solution for infusion vials were first listed on the ARTG on 2 November 2021.
